What is the most important job of the executive branch?

The executive branch of the U.S. government is responsible for enforcing laws; its power is vested in the President. The executive branch of the United States is responsible for the implementation and enforcement of the laws passed by the legislative branch as they have been interpreted by the judicial branch.
